The incident took place last night when the victim, Shivmilan Singh, a gym owner in city's Anand Nagar, was travelling from from Pathardi Phata and was intercepted by four persons near Vadner Gate on the Nashik Devlali camp road, in-charge of Upnagar police station, Bajirao Mahajan said.
According to the complaint lodged by Singh, he was stopped and forcibly taken out of his car by assailants, who then fired rounds from a revolver. A bullet hit his left hand, injuring him severely.
Deputy Commissioner of Police (circle no.2), Shrikrishna Kokate, however, suspect that Singh, who has offences of dacoity and extortion lodged against him, himself staged the attack on him as he had borrowed a large sum of money several people and was under pressure to repay them.
